CVE-2026-57832CriticalPublished 14 July 2026

EDocman (com_edocman) below 3.9 - Unauthenticated SQL Injection (full database read)

A public front-end endpoint in EDocman (the document and download manager for Joomla by JoomDonation) placed a request parameter into a database query without sanitising it, an unauthenticated SQL injection (CWE-89). An anonymous visitor, with no login, no CSRF token and no user interaction, could read data from any table in the site database in a single request: user accounts, bcrypt password hashes, password reset tokens and the Joomla secret. Both error-based (fast) and time-based blind extraction work. Where the site connects to MySQL with a privileged account, the read reaches every database on that server, not just this site. mySites.guru discovered and reported this privately; JoomDonation fixed it in EDocman 3.9 (released 14 July 2026). Affects 3.8 and earlier. Update to 3.9 or later immediately. Interim mitigation: a web application firewall with SQL injection filtering enabled can block many attempts, but it is mitigation, not a fix. CVSS 4.0 8.7 (High), our own assessment; CVE pending via the Joomla CNA.

Affected versions: < 3.9
